189;; Constants used for font-lock.
190
191;; Only a small set of the PostScript operators is selected for fontification.
192;; Fontification is meant to clarify the document structure and process flow,
193;; fontifying all known PostScript operators would hinder that objective.
194(defconst ps-mode-operators
195 (let ((ops '("clear" "mark" "cleartomark" "counttomark"
196 "forall"
197 "dict" "begin" "end" "def"
198 "true" "false"
199 "exec" "if" "ifelse" "for" "repeat" "loop" "exit"
200 "stop" "stopped" "countexecstack" "execstack"
201 "quit" "start"
202 "save" "restore"
203 "bind" "null"
204 "gsave" "grestore" "grestoreall"
205 "showpage")))
206 (concat "\\<" (regexp-opt ops t) "\\>"))
627a4e30 207 "Regexp of PostScript operators that will be fontified.")

209;; Level 1 font-lock:
210;; - Special comments (reference face)
211;; - Strings and other comments
212;; - Partial strings (warning face)
213;; - 8bit characters (warning face)
214;; Multiline strings are not supported. Strings with nested brackets are.
215(defconst ps-mode-font-lock-keywords-1
216 '(("\\`%!PS.*" . font-lock-reference-face)
627a4e30 217 ("^%%BoundingBox:[ \t]+-?[0-9]+[ \t]+-?[0-9]+[ \t]+-?[0-9]+[ \t]+-?[0-9]+[ \t]*$"
99485bca
GM
218 . font-lock-reference-face)
219 (ps-mode-match-string-or-comment
220 (1 font-lock-comment-face nil t)
221 (2 font-lock-string-face nil t))
222 ("([^()\n%]*\\|[^()\n]*)" . font-lock-warning-face)
223 ("[\200-\377]+" (0 font-lock-warning-face prepend nil)))
224 "Subdued level highlighting for PostScript mode.")
225
226;; Level 2 font-lock:
227;; - All from level 1
228;; - PostScript operators (keyword face)
229(defconst ps-mode-font-lock-keywords-2
230 (append
231 ps-mode-font-lock-keywords-1
232 (list
233 (cons
234 ;; exclude names prepended by `/'
235 (concat "\\(^\\|[^/\n]\\)" ps-mode-operators)
236 '(2 font-lock-keyword-face))))
237 "Medium level highlighting for PostScript mode.")
238
239;; Level 3 font-lock:
240;; - All from level 2
241;; - Immediately evaluated names: those starting with `//' (type face)
242;; - Names that look like they are used for the definition of:
243;; * a function
244;; * an array
245;; * a dictionary
246;; * a "global" variable
247;; (function name face)
248;; - Other names (variable name face)
249;; The rules used to determine what names fit in the first category are:
250;; - Only names that are at the left margin, and one of these on the same line:
251;; * Nothing after the name except possibly one or more `[' or a comment
252;; * A `{' or `<<' or `[0-9]+ dict' following the name
253;; * A `def' somewhere in the same line
254;; Names are fontified before PostScript operators, allowing the use of
255;; a more simple (efficient) regexp than the one used in level 2.
256(defconst ps-mode-font-lock-keywords-3
257 (append
258 ps-mode-font-lock-keywords-1
259 (list
260 '("//\\w+" . font-lock-type-face)
6114f9e5
RS
261 `(,(concat
262 "^\\(/\\w+\\)\\>"
263 "\\([[ \t]*\\(%.*\\)?\r?$" ; Nothing but `[' or comment after the name.
264 "\\|[ \t]*\\({\\|<<\\)" ; `{' or `<<' following the name.
265 "\\|[ \t]+[0-9]+[ \t]+dict\\>" ; `[0-9]+ dict' following the name.
266 "\\|.*\\<def\\>\\)") ; `def' somewhere on the same line.
99485bca
GM
267 . (1 font-lock-function-name-face))
268 '("/\\w+" . font-lock-variable-name-face)
269 (cons ps-mode-operators 'font-lock-keyword-face)))
270 "High level highliting for PostScript mode.")

816(defun ps-mode-center ()
817 "Insert function /center."
818 (interactive)
819 (insert "
820/center {
821 dup stringwidth
822 exch 2 div neg
823 exch 2 div neg
824 rmoveto
825} bind def
826"))
827
828(defun ps-mode-right ()
829 "Insert function /right."
830 (interactive)
831 (insert "
832/right {
833 dup stringwidth
834 exch neg
835 exch neg
836 rmoveto
837} bind def
838"))
839
840(defun ps-mode-RE ()
841 "Insert function /RE."
842 (interactive)
843 (insert "
844% `new-font-name' `encoding-vector' `old-font-name' RE -
845/RE {
846 findfont
847 dup maxlength dict begin {
848 1 index /FID ne { def } { pop pop } ifelse
849 } forall
850 /Encoding exch def
851 dup /FontName exch def
852 currentdict end definefont pop
853} bind def
854"))

900(defun ps-mode-heapsort ()
901 "Insert function /Heapsort."
902 (interactive)
903 (insert "
904% `array-element' Heapsort-cvi-or-cvr-or-cvs `number-or-string'
905/Heapsort-cvi-or-cvr-or-cvs {
906 % 0 get
907} bind def
908% `array' Heapsort `sorted-array'
909/Heapsort {
910 dup length /hsR exch def
911 /hsL hsR 2 idiv 1 add def
912 {
913 hsR 2 lt { exit } if
914 hsL 1 gt {
915 /hsL hsL 1 sub def
916 } {
917 /hsR hsR 1 sub def
918 dup dup dup 0 get exch dup hsR get
919 0 exch put
920 hsR exch put
921 } ifelse
922 dup hsL 1 sub get /hsT exch def
923 /hsJ hsL def
924 {
925 /hsS hsJ def
926 /hsJ hsJ dup add def
927 hsJ hsR gt { exit } if
928 hsJ hsR lt {
929 dup dup hsJ 1 sub get Heapsort-cvi-or-cvr-or-cvs
930 exch hsJ get Heapsort-cvi-or-cvr-or-cvs
931 lt { /hsJ hsJ 1 add def } if
932 } if
933 dup hsJ 1 sub get Heapsort-cvi-or-cvr-or-cvs
934 hsT Heapsort-cvi-or-cvr-or-cvs
935 le { exit } if
936 dup dup hsS 1 sub exch hsJ 1 sub get put
937 } loop
938 dup hsS 1 sub hsT put
939 } loop
940} bind def
941"))
